This is exactly the thing that irritated me about OoP.  At the end of 
GoF, Dumbledore is gearing up for war, Fudge has jammed his head 
firmly into the sand, and sides are beginning to be taken.  Then 
Harry gets shuffled off to another crappy summer at the Dursleys, 
school starts, and DD tries to get everyone to pretend that it's 
simply school as usual.  The entire time they are dealing with 
Umbridge and everyone is tiptoeing around, I was shaking my book and 
screaming, "HELLO???  Anyone remember Voldemort?  That guy that's out 
there?  Most likely plotting something horrible?  Remember him?  Why 
are we worried about OWLS and detention?"  I was heartily let down to 
find that LV was after something as trite as a prophecy.  I expected 
him to be out there creating monsters to fight for him.  Or 
Polyjuicing all of the DEs.  Or creating some scheme to mow down 
Hogwarts and crush Potter once and for all.  But no, LV is looking 
for some prophecy and Harry is studying potions and arguing with 
Snape.  Quite a letdown after GoF.  I hope she ramps it up a bit for 
HBP.
